This movie is an interesting and enjoyable blend of comedy, suspense and romance. Unusual to say the least and the plot does work despite the crazy story idea about invisible ink on a woman's back! Well worth seeing. Excellent acting and just fun to watch.
The film plays out straight-forwardly with no real suspense and far too much comedy that isn't necessarily funny. Especially from the dithering Roland Young (Ronald) as a British envoy. There is an amusing sequence of events that involves Goddard, Dekker and Young at the beginning of the film when both Dekker and Young ask Goddard to remove her clothing. But that is the only stand-out scene apart from the beginning when Hayes gets her tattoo. The film also scores points for the hotel rooms and Goddard's outfits. However, the film is nothing more than an OK time-passer.
She travels to Lisbon to auction the plans off to the highest bidder, planning to travel under the name of a female reporter (Paulette Goddard) going to work for a tough-minded newsman (Ray Milland). Unfortunately, the spy is delayed so when Goddard arrives everyone thinks she's the agent, and they chase after her for the plans.
Clear, so far?
Roland Young plays the English agent who wants to see the plans before bidding. The Germans are also included in the auction. But Goddard thinks everyone is after her for herself. I've known women like that, myself. Young ropes Milland into the game, adding to the confusion.
The confusion generates some humor, especially from Young.
When she finds out the truth, Goddard ventures alone into the National Socialist embassy, fishing for a story. What could go wrong?
For such a slight little yarn this movie has a surprisingly strong cast, and they do what comedies are supposed to do: try for laughs. The third act turns serious, changing the tone and making it a tad schizophrenic. But it is wartime so a little propaganda is understandable.

- WissenswertesFirst of four screen pairings of Paulette Goddard and Ray Milland as headliners, being followed by Piraten im Karibischen Meer (1942), The Crystal Ball (1943), and Eine Lady mit Vergangenheit (1945): Goddard and Milland were also both featured in the Paramount specialty film Star Spangled Rhythm (1942). Milland was slated to be Goddard's leading man in Bride of Vengeance (1949) but refused the role.
